Hello, our elderly mother needs to move in and Seymour, our 60 lb. hound dog is going to freak out by this change. He is a nervous fellow and because of this, we have to make the toughest decision and rehome him. While Seymour is has never bitten anyone, he looks and sounds aggressive when it comes to strangers and we need to avoid any fear based accidents. The original rescue we got Seymour from has no room to take Seymour back, and even if they did, we don't know if that would be an ideal situation. We have tried everything to manage Seymour's high anxiety. He is on 2 types of medication and have worked with a Behaviorist at TUFTS. Training and meds have helped and he is in a good routine. That being said, he still has some guarding tendencies that concern us when bringing and elderly parent into the home. Seymour does well with his older sister Ruby who is a 10 year lab/Rottweiler, though we wouldn't suggest a smaller dog or a cat. If you could keep him out of the way safely in your home and not give him access to a main entrance this could work in a home as well. We cannot surrender him to a shelter, he could not handle that. If a home cannot be found, he will need to be humanely euthanized with us all around him. Please consider if Seymour might be a fit for your family.
